DNA Barcoding Takes Bioassessment Further: New Distribution Records for Aquatic Macroinvertebrates from Alaskan National Parks
Abstract. DNA barcoding was applied to select macroinvertebrates from aquatic bioassessment samples collected from National Parks and Preserves in Alaska, USA. The finer taxonomic resolution provided by barcoding revealed the presence of 28 insect species previously unreported from Alaska; 21 of these are also new records for the USA, and 7 are new records for North America, excluding Greenland. The new records are distributed among Diptera: Ceratopogonidae (1), Chironomidae (20), Limoniidae (1), and Tipulidae (1); Ephemeroptera: Baetidae (2); and Trichoptera: Apataniidae (1), Goeridae (1), and Leptoceridae (1).

The Proceedings of the Entomological Society of Washington is published four times a year in January, April, July, and October. The journal publishes on all aspects of original research in entomology. Subject matter includes systematics, taxonomy, biology, behavior, ecology, morphology, genetics, and other topics.
